This 8051 microcontroller board is a compact, ready-to-use development platform designed for students, hobbyists and embedded engineers. It supports Atmel 8051, 8052, 8032/31 series microcontrollers and includes onboard regulated 5V supply, LCD, 7-segment displays, switches, LEDs, buzzer and Bluetooth interface for quick testing and prototyping. All 32 I/O pins are broken out through male connectors, making it ideal as a main board for custom applications and training setups. The professional glass PCB layout helps reduce noise and improves reliability. This board is perfect for academic labs, project work and learning embedded C or assembly. Connect a 7–20V DC supply to the screw terminal and set the jumper for external power. Insert a compatible 8051 series microcontroller into the socket. Connect peripherals to the breakout headers if needed. Program the MCU using your preferred programmer. Use the onboard LCD, keys, LEDs, buzzer and Bluetooth for testing and debugging applications.

Yes, the board includes an onboard 7805 voltage regulator that provides a stable +5V supply from a 7–20V external input via screw terminal. A jumper lets you select external power. This built-in regulation protects the microcontroller and simplifies powering the entire 8051 microcontroller board and connected peripherals safely.

This 8051 microcontroller board includes a 2x16 LCD, two multiplexed 7-segment displays, eight keys, eight LEDs, a buzzer and an HC-05 Bluetooth interface. Additionally, all 32 I/O pins are available on male connectors, allowing you to attach extra modules, relays, sensors or communication interfaces for advanced embedded applications.
